Understanding the Arena and Environmental Hazards

Layout and Design

The arena in which Queen Muff is fought is designed to heighten tension. It consists of narrow walkways, multi-level platforms, and occasional environmental hazards such as energy surges and toxic gas vents. Movement is key, and players must constantly be on the lookout for unstable tiles and shifting walls.

  • Rotating Walls: These can either open new routes or trap the player, forcing quick thinking and map awareness.
  • Toxic Gas Zones: Appear in fixed intervals, limiting safe zones and funneling movement.
  • Energy Fields: High-voltage zones that appear randomly and inflict heavy damage.

Environmental Advantages

Players can use elevated positions to gain a better angle on Queen Muff, especially during her channeling phases. Certain explosive barrels or energy nodes can also be triggered for bonus damage if timed right, although they are limited in number.

Queen Muff’s Attack Patterns and Phases

Phase One – Swarm Control

Queen Muff opens the fight by summoning autonomous drones that harass and distract players. These units do moderate damage but can quickly overwhelm if not dealt with. Queen Muff herself maintains distance, firing bursts of plasma shots and deploying mines that track player movement.

  • Use AoE weapons to clear drone swarms early.
  • Keep moving to avoid proximity mines and their delayed explosions.
  • Look for visual cues her core glows red before plasma attacks.

Phase Two – Aggressive Engagement

Once she drops below 70% health, Queen Muff shifts into a more mobile and aggressive stance. She teleports across the arena, launching wave attacks that knock players back and disable movement for a short time. This phase also introduces her devastatingNeural Lance, a direct laser strike that homes in on player location after a brief charge.

Evading her during this stage requires both vertical and lateral movement. Utilize grapples or climbable structures to keep distance and break her line of sight during the Neural Lance wind-up.

Phase Three – Final Stand

At 30% health, Queen Muff enters her final phase. The arena begins collapsing, removing certain platforms and exposing dangerous hazards. Her attacks become more erratic, combining all previous abilities with increased speed and shorter telegraph windows.

She also gains the ability to summon an elite variant of her drones calledMufflings, which explode upon death. Players must balance attacking Queen Muff while avoiding both environmental dangers and suicidal adds.

Recommended Loadouts and Gear

Primary Weapons

  • Pulse Carbine: High fire rate and strong against drone waves.
  • Railgun: Ideal for burst damage during her brief stationary phases.

Secondary Options

  • EMP Grenades: Temporarily disables drones and weakens her shields.
  • Stimulant Injector: Increases movement speed and cooldown recovery.

Armor and Mods

  • Reactive Shielding: Absorbs one instance of high-damage output like Neural Lance.
  • Toxin Filter Mod: Reduces damage from toxic zones in the arena.

Co-op Strategies for Queen Muff

When playing in co-op, coordination is essential. Assign roles such as drone-clear, boss-focus, and utility-support. Communicate cooldowns, enemy positions, and environmental hazards to ensure minimal overlap and reduced chaos.

  • Use staggered grenade tosses to ensure constant crowd control.
  • Revive downed players only during movement lulls.
  • Designate one player to bait the Neural Lance while others DPS.
